=========================================================== .___ __ __ _________________ __ __ __| _/|__|/ |_ / ___\_` __ \__ \ | | \/ __ | | \\_ __\ / /_/ > | \// __ \| | / /_/ | | || | \___ /|__| (____ /____/\____ | |__||__| /_____/ \/ \/ grep rough audit - static analysis tool v2.8 written by @Wireghoul =================================[justanotherhacker.com]=== mha4mysql-node-0.58/bin/apply_diff_relay_logs-236-sub use_binary_mode() { mha4mysql-node-0.58/bin/apply_diff_relay_logs:237: my $v = `$_mysql --version`; mha4mysql-node-0.58/bin/apply_diff_relay_logs-238- my $mysqlclient_version; ############################################## mha4mysql-node-0.58/bin/apply_diff_relay_logs-307- # applying log failed mha4mysql-node-0.58/bin/apply_diff_relay_logs:308: if ( my $rc = system($command) ) { mha4mysql-node-0.58/bin/apply_diff_relay_logs-309- my ( $high, $low ) = MHA::NodeUtil::system_rc($rc); ############################################## mha4mysql-node-0.58/bin/apply_diff_relay_logs-312- hostname(), $err_file ); mha4mysql-node-0.58/bin/apply_diff_relay_logs:313: system("tail -200 $err_file"); mha4mysql-node-0.58/bin/apply_diff_relay_logs-314- ############################################## mha4mysql-node-0.58/bin/purge_relay_logs-165- my $file = basename($log_error_path); mha4mysql-node-0.58/bin/purge_relay_logs:166: `cat "$dir/$file-old" >> "$dir/$file-saved"` if ( -f "$dir/$file-old" ); mha4mysql-node-0.58/bin/purge_relay_logs-167- } ############################################## m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-105- } mha4mysql-node-0.58/lib/MHA/BinlogManager.pm:106: my $v = `$self->{mysqlbinlog} --version`; m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-107- my ( $high, $low ) = MHA::NodeUtil::system_rc($?); ############################################## m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-368- # higher than binlog file header (4 bytes) mha4mysql-node-0.58/lib/MHA/BinlogManager.pm:369: return system("$self->{mysqlbinlog} --stop-position=5 $file > /dev/null"); m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-370-} ############################################## m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-525- "echo \"# Binary/Relay log file $from_file started\" >> $out_diff_file"; mha4mysql-node-0.58/lib/MHA/BinlogManager.pm:526: system($command); m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-527- ############################################## m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-544- mha4mysql-node-0.58/lib/MHA/BinlogManager.pm:545: $rc = system($command); mha4mysql-node-0.58/lib/MHA/BinlogManager.pm-546- if ($rc) { ############################################## m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-60- mha4mysql-node-0.58/lib/MHA/NodeUtil.pm:61: my $local_md5 = `md5sum $local_file`; m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-62- return 1 if ($?); ############################################## m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-66- my $remote_md5 = mha4mysql-node-0.58/lib/MHA/NodeUtil.pm:67:`ssh $MHA::NodeConst::SSH_OPT_ALIVE -p $ssh_port $ssh_user_host \"md5sum $remote_path\"`; m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-68- return 1 if ($?); ############################################## m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-106- if ( mha4mysql-node-0.58/lib/MHA/NodeUtil.pm:107: system($copy_command) m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-108- || compare_checksum( ############################################## m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-114- if ($log_output) { mha4mysql-node-0.58/lib/MHA/NodeUtil.pm:115: system("echo $msg >> $log_output 2>&1"); mha4mysql-node-0.58/lib/MHA/NodeUtil.pm-116- }